2、以下命令关联本地和远程仓库,*****为我的用户名
????git remote add origin git@github.com:**/manage.git
3、本地已经有项目代码了在add和commit之后,想要push到远程仓库
????git push origin master
此时报错:
! [rejected] master -> master (non-fast forward)
????…………
????…………
在网上搜了好久,输入了各种无效和错误的命令后,终于找到了解决办法:
1、git pull origin master --allow-unrelated-histories //把远程仓库和本地同步,消除差异
2、重新add和commit相应文件
3、git push origin master
4、此时就能够上传成功了
原文:https://blog.51cto.com/11585002/2451060